Understanding Autoimmune Conditions and the Need for Support
Autoimmune diseases occur when the body's immune system mistakenly attacks its own healthy tissues. This can manifest in a wide range of conditions, including multiple sclerosis, rheumatoid arthritis, lupus, and type 1 diabetes. The unpredictable nature of these illnesses often leads to periods of remission and relapse, making consistent management and emotional resilience crucial.
